錯誤可能有兩點
第一個是執行測試之后,trace里面會說數據庫只讀。解決方法是降低你的mysql驅動版本 我這里用的是5.05成功運行的
第二個是亂碼問題。
亂碼問題主要檢查你的數據庫編碼格式是不是UTF-8的
還有檢查你的配置文檔
<property name="connection.url">jdbc:mysql://localhost:3306/learn?useUnicode=true&amp;characterEncoding=UTF-8</property>
第一個是執行測試之后,trace里面會說數據庫只讀。解決方法是降低你的mysql驅動版本 我這里用的是5.05成功運行的
第二個是亂碼問題。
亂碼問題主要檢查你的數據庫編碼格式是不是UTF-8的
還有檢查你的配置文檔
<property name="connection.url">jdbc:mysql://localhost:3306/learn?useUnicode=true&amp;characterEncoding=UTF-8</property>
2016-10-19
如果你將所有的對象都刪除的話,在刪除完最后一個的時候,數據還是會顯示在學生列表頁;但是數據庫中的數據已經清除了,在StudentAction類的delete方法中
session.delete(s);后面添加這句代碼就可解決session.flush();
這樣是清空session中緩存;
session.delete(s);后面添加這句代碼就可解決session.flush();
這樣是清空session中緩存;
2016-10-18
最新回答 / 丶Mr
應該是導入的struts2和hibernate的包沖突了 。 我建議你要不就用MyEclipse 重新自動搭建一個struts2+hibernate的框架 。然后把struts2的antlr-2.7.2 刪除就行了 然后從新開始寫就可以了
2016-10-17
最新回答 / 淡淡的零碎
已經解決這個問題啦:Window->Preferences->MyEclipse->Servers->tomcat->launch->run mode(其中,點擊tomcat的時候是你部署項目的那個tomcat,一一般是tomcat6x),這樣就可以把它設置成普通模式了~
2016-10-14